Abstract

The present study aimed to evaluate the antioxidant activity of petroleum ether, methanolic extracts and active ingredients separated from Eucalyptus globulus using three different antioxidant assays: 2,2 diphenyl picryl hydrazyl (DPPH), 2,2’- azino-bis [ethylbenzthiazoline-6-sulfonic acid] (ABTS) and β-carotene bleaching assay and identify the mode of action. The results revealed that, crude methanolic extract showed higher antioxidant activity against both DPPH and ABTS radicals than petroleum ether extract. The promising methanol soluble fraction of Eucalyptus globulus wood was fractionated on a silica gel column, using hexane, chloroform and ethyl acetate as the mobile phase to give three fractions (C1, C2 and C3), and both the antioxidant activity and chemical composition for raw and fractions were determined. One of the fractions isolated (C2) showed a remarkable antioxidant activity (EC50 of 64.4 µg/ml, in comparison with 52.74 µg/ml for crude extracts) against ABTS radical method, and the chemical structures of separated active ingredients were identified using different spectroscopic methods such as 17-pentatricontene (C1), N,N-diphenyllauramide (C2) and O-benzyl-N-tert-butoxycarbonyl-D-serine (C3). Also, the mode of action of the promising fraction was determined.

Introduction

Eucalyptus globulus is one of the main forest species in Galicia, representing 27% of total wood volume. Eucalyptus contains many chemical compounds that play several roles in the plant These include defense against insect and vertebrate herbivores and protection against UV radiation and against cold stress. The synthetic antioxidants include butylated hydroxyanisole and butylated hidroxytoluene (BHA and BHT, respectively), propyl gallate (PG) and tertbutylhydroquinone (TBHQ). Their manufacture costs, the relative poor efficiency of natural tocopherols ( used as antioxidant agents) and the need of increased food additive safety give rise to a crescent demand on other natural and safe antioxidants sources. Extractions of phenolic compounds as antioxidants from eucalyptus (Eucalyptus globulus) bark were done by Vázquez et al [8] who demonstrated the potential of eucalyptus bark as a source of antioxidant compounds. This investigation was designed to identify the mechanism of active ingredients isolated from Eucalyptus globulus for their antioxidant activity, using three different antioxidant methods
